Tokyo International Film Festival unveils the competition programming

The Tokyo International Film Festival (TIFF, October 27-November 5) unveiled its full range, including its main competition section, with the world’s leading worlds such as Rithy Panh, Amos Gitai, Chong Keat Aun and Zhang Lu.
Rithy Panh of Cambodia will bring her documentary We are the fruits of the forestOn the ethnic minorities in northern Cambodia, at the festival, while the Israeli filmmaker Amos Gitai will be presented in first Golem in Pompeywhich documents his play organized in a theater of the ancient city of Pompei, combined with fictitious sequences.
Chong Keiat Aun Mother Bhumi Stars fan bingbing as a woman in a Malaysian village in the 1990s, discovering the truth behind the death of her husband, while Zhang Lu, fresh to win the Best Busan film Prize for Gloaming in Luomuis presenting Mortal tongueWith Bai Baihe, in Tokyo. Bai plays an actress in difficulty returning to her hometown in Sichuan in the new film of Zhang.
Other first world in the competition programming include BlondAbout a teacher taken in a scandal, directed by the Japanese filmmaker Yuichiro Sakashita; Chinese director Peng Fei Take off, About a Chinese worker obsessed with the construction of an in itself theft machine; and family drama Maria Vitoria Mario sponsorship of Portugal.
Films receiving their first Asian at the festival include Kitchen Death Du Pen-Ek Ratanaruang in Thailand, the Hungarian filmmaker Gyorgy Palfi Chicken and the historic drama of Annemarie Jacir Palestine 36 (See the full range below).
Tiff also announced the 11 films which will receive their first world in the future Asian section of the first, second and third films in all of Asia and the Middle East (See the full range below).
As announced previously, Junji Sakamoto Climb for lifeA biopic by Japanese mountaineer Junko Tabei will play the festival’s opening film, while Chloé Zhao Hamnet Will select like the closing film. Yoji Yamada Taxi from Tokyo was defined as the mismanagement of the centerpiece.
Gala projections include Ari Aster EddingtonScott Cooper Springsteen: Delive Me de Nowhere; Juno Mak Son of the NEON Night; Lim dae Holy Night: Demon huntersWith Done Lee and Hikari Rental familyAmong other titles. Several Japanese films will also receive gala projections, including Koji Fukada Love in trialsKasho Iizuka Blue Boy trial And Yuichiro Sakashita I can’t cry with your face.
Japanese cinema will now project a mixture of world first and realizations of festivals such as Yukari Sakamoto White flowers and fruits And Akio Fujimoto Lost land. The other major festival sections include the TIFF series, the World Focus, the empowerment of women, young people, animation and Japanese classics.
Among the masterclasses and other events, the festival is again organizing a series of Tiff Lounge discussions between the main filmmakers, including a session with Yoji Yamada and Good morning The director Lee Sang-il, while the filmmaker of Hong Kong, Soil, will deliver a masterclass.
Tokyo also launched a new section, Asian Students’ Film Conference, a live film and animated film competition of less than 60 minutes recommended by film schools from all over Asia, including titles rewarded in Cannes and other festivals. Supported by the Metropolitan government of Tokyo, this section will project 15 films with emerging Asian talents during the festival.
